libib Library Manager is a digital library management platform designed primarily for individual users, educators, and small institutions. It enables users to organize, catalog, and track their physical and digital book collections with an easy-to-use interface, making it simple to maintain a personal or shared library database.
Key Features
- User-friendly interface for cataloging books, movies, games, and more
- Supports barcode scanning for efficient item entry
- Cloud-based storage for seamless access across devices
- Customizable categories and tags for organization
- Mobile app compatibility for on-the-go management
- Integration with online marketplaces and services like Amazon and Goodreads
- Options for sharing collections with friends or colleagues
Pros
- Intuitive and accessible interface that simplifies library management
- Reliable cloud synchronization ensuring data consistency across devices
- Supports a variety of media types beyond books, including movies and games
- Useful barcode scanning feature speeds up cataloging process
- Flexible organizational tools like tags and custom categories
Cons
- Limited advanced features for large or complex library systems
- Some users report occasional syncing issues or bugs
- Free tier has limited storage; full features require a subscription
- Lacks comprehensive analytics or detailed reporting options
